A member asked:

I have had a tension/mild soreness/ache in my left shoulder/neck for the past 10 years, starting with a sneeze on a bicycle. how can i fix it?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Eliminate the pain: First thing is to try to determine cause to check for any fracture, calcium deposits with xrays and medical checkup with bloodwork to look for arthritis/gout. If it turns out to be muscular/tension/bursitis of shoulder neck, then first eliminate pain with ice packs, antiinflammatories, rest and after pain relieved begin physical therapy/myofascial/stretching and finally strengthen muscles.
